Safety Safety Intended use The flame scanner shall be used exclusively to detect flames in combination with a suitable flame amplifier. The flame scanner and flame amplifier together constitute a complete flame amplifiering system for burners with a ran- dom capacity and random fuels in single and multiple burner systems.

Transport, installation and connection 4.7.3 Handling of the KW5-Shieldings Outer shielding: The outer shielding is only connected to the device via the cable gland. On the loose cable end the shielding should be cut off short. Inner shielding: The inner shielding has to be connected to ground of the flame amplifier side.

Description Description Functional description The OE- Converter 4.1L utilizes the well approved inte- gral procedure of the flame radiation analysis. The radia- tion sensed by a photo element is immediately pro- cessed by a control circuit (AGC) optimizing the operat- ing point of the flame scanner in relation with the fuel ra- diation.
Description High pass filter The flame scanner is equipped with an adjustable high- pass-filter, which eliminates unwanted flame signals from lower frequency sources like neighbour flames or fireball radiations. The filter can be set as follows: DIP-switch position Frequency Medium High...
